Senate Bill 1227 Summary
-
Extends the expiration date for aerospace sector tax credits from January 1, 2015 to January 1, 2018 in Oklahoma income tax law.
-
Modifies definitions in the aerospace tax credit provisions, including clarifying "compensation" to reference IRS Form 1099 and specifying that qualified employees must be engineers in the aerospace sector.
-
Maintains three existing tax credit programs: tuition reimbursement credits (up to 50% for employers), employee compensation credits (5-10% depending on graduation location, capped at $12,500 annually), and employee tax credits (up to $5,000 per year for five years).
-
Applies to qualified employers and employees in the aerospace industry meeting specific education requirements from ABET-accredited engineering programs.
-
Becomes effective November 1, 2014.
